Zakary
Zakary
另外可以考虑顺便修复这个 #12387,并提供 `getLaunchOptionsSync` API
> 我本地无法完成安装, 之前PR都是盲改的, 有什么好的建议吗? 让我可以本地跑用例那种. > >  这是 puppeteer 安装的问题,设置环境变量 PUPPETEER_SKIP_CHROMIUM_DOWNLOAD 跳过安装就行
> > 另外可以考虑顺便修复这个 #12387,并提供 `getLaunchOptionsSync` API > > 我研究一下, 还不太熟. 刚刚看 PR 的时候顺手修了 😂
> 提了一些问题,主要集中在依赖的治理上,也能反射到对整个项目上,我们以后应该怎样治理各种依赖。@zhiqingchen @ZakaryCode 两位可以一起讨论下。 依赖治理还是如双周会上所说,如果在包内使用的依赖需要明确标注,这样不论是增减依赖还是升级都有明确的方向可以验证。 根目录已有的依赖可以尽可能移除,包括项目内各个包的链接还有包对应的 types 依赖,根目录依赖只应保留包括 husky 在内用于项目治理的依赖。 最后关于项目版本,除 webpack 这类特殊依赖不同包会依赖不同版本需要,其它依赖应尽可能统一版本,或至少在大版本上统一;如有特殊处理或需要的锁定版本的情况,应在对应包的 readme 中说明情况,并注明版本升级的条件便于后续验证。
小程序组件不需要额外的国际化实现,不过 h5 和 rn 可以考虑增加该特性
未能复现到该问题
> touch 事件不灵敏,将事件绑定改为直接绑定在host节点上,不再加入子节点 这个组件目前还没有测试用例,结构性变更还是先加一下用例比较好一点 > 此种方式会有一个问题,当用户在movable-view上也绑定touch事件时,用户绑定的touch事件和组件内部的touch事件执行顺序会有问题,第一次是用户绑定的事件先触发,后续的事件都是组件内部的事件先触发 在代码和文档内做一下标注把,记录一下版本和相关问题 > 引起这个问题的原因是现在使用的react桥接stencil绑定事件机制引起,可后续看下是否有好的方式调整,当用户碰到此问题时,可以在自己绑定的事件中使用set-timeout临时处理 保证每次的执行顺序一致 在 vue 中是否会有类似的问题,改动之后有相关的验证不
可尝试升级版本修复该问题
目前确实没有支持,可以和 `getLaunchOptionsSync` 方法一起实现
临时修复参考配置如下: ```js // ... prebundle: { swc: { jsc: { target: 'es5' } }, }, // ... ``` > 已经在 PR #12491 中修复,将在下一个版本释出